Why did the British Monarchy's believe that they had a right to tax the colonies in order to help finance the French and Indian War?

OpenStudy (anonymous):

A. The Monarcy believed that all people under their rule should pay regardless of the circumstances. B England's economy was suffering and they couldn't finance the war without taking money from the colonies. C. They believed that the colonies started the French and Indian war so therefore they should pay for it. D. England believed it was protecting the colonists from French and Indian threats and from the British point of view, colonists should help pay for it.
